Tools and Technologies for Java Full Stack Training

  • Java Programming Platform: Java remains the structural backbone of full stack training because it teaches developers how to build stable, scalable backend logic. Learners use it to understand object-oriented thinking and long-term software maintainability. Its platform independence allows applications to run consistently across environments. Training focuses on writing reusable code that survives product evolution. Mastery of Java gives students confidence to move into advanced frameworks.
  • Spring Boot Framework: Spring Boot accelerates backend development by removing heavy configuration overhead. Students learn how to create production-ready services quickly and efficiently. It introduces dependency management in a practical, hands-on way. Training emphasizes building REST services that integrate smoothly with front-end systems. This framework mirrors how enterprise applications are built in real companies.
  • React Interface Library: React teaches learners how to design responsive and dynamic user interfaces. Its component-driven structure promotes reusable front-end architecture. Students understand how interface performance affects user experience. Training focuses on building interactive applications that feel fast and intuitive. React prepares developers for modern UI expectations.
  • MySQL Database System: MySQL introduces structured data management and relational database thinking. Learners practice designing schemas that support scalable applications. Training highlights efficient querying and data consistency. Students understand how backend logic connects to real information storage. Database literacy ensures applications remain reliable under heavy usage.
  • Git Version Control System: Git builds discipline in collaborative software development. Students learn how to track changes without risking project stability. Training mirrors workflows used by professional engineering teams. Version control encourages organized coding habits. Git prepares learners for real multi-developer environments.
  • Docker Container Platform: Docker helps developers package applications into portable environments. Students see how containers remove compatibility problems across systems. Training explains how deployment becomes predictable and repeatable. Learners understand how modern infrastructure supports scaling. Docker bridges development with operational thinking.
  • Maven Build Tool: Maven organizes project dependencies and automates build processes. Students learn structured project management within Java ecosystems. Training shows how large teams maintain consistency. Automated builds reduce manual errors. Maven teaches discipline in handling complex codebases.
  • Jenkins Automation Server: Jenkins introduces continuous integration into daily development routines. Students understand how automated testing protects software quality. Training connects coding with deployment workflows. Learners experience how fast releases remain stable. Jenkins reflects real DevOps environments.
  • Node.js Runtime: Node.js expands learners’ perspective on server-side processing. Students explore asynchronous and event-driven architecture. Training demonstrates how lightweight services handle high traffic. This tool encourages flexible backend thinking. Node.js strengthens problem-solving across stacks.
  • Kubernetes Orchestration Platform: Kubernetes teaches how containerized applications scale across distributed systems. Students learn orchestration strategies used in cloud infrastructure. Training focuses on maintaining uptime and performance. Learners connect development with large-scale deployment thinking. Kubernetes prepares developers for automated system management.

Industry Projects

Project 1
E-Commerce Website Project

Build a fully functional online store with product management, shopping cart, payment integration, and user authentication. Gain practical experience in combining front-end and back-end development.

Project 2
Dashboard & Analytics Application

Develop an interactive dashboard using Angular/React for the front-end and Java Spring Boot for the back-end. Implement real-time analytics, reporting features, and data visualization for enterprise-level applications.

Project 3
REST API Development Project

Create secure and scalable REST APIs with Java Spring Boot and Hibernate, integrate with SQL and NoSQL databases, and implement authentication, CRUD operations, and error handling.
